In what order do you cook stir fry?

How to Stir-Fry:

1. Prep: Prepare your ingredients. Julienne vegetables, slice meat thinly, and use an aromatics blend of minced garlic, ginger, scallion whites and chili (optional).

2. Heat: Heat your wok or large pan on high until it starts to smoke. Add some oil and swirl to coat.

3. Meat: If cooking with meat, add it and stir fry until browned (not completely cooked). Remove from the wok and set aside.

4. Aromatics: Add your aromatics (garlic, ginger, scallions) and stir-fry until fragrant (30sec-1min).

5. Veggies: Add vegetables in order of cooking time. Start with long-cooking veggies like carrots, broccoli or bell pepper.

6. Sauce: Add your stir fry sauce (premixed or combine soy, Shaoxing wine, dark soy, sesame oil, a little cornstarch and water). Bring to boil and reduce heat.

7. Protein: Add your cooked meat or tofu back into the wok along with any greens or quick-cooking veggies (like baby bok choy, pea pods).

8. Finish: Stir fry until everything is just tender. Add cornstarch mixture if desired for a thickened sauce. Serve over rice.
